Palin is known as chic but cheap at stores in Alaska

Ms. Palin recently dropped over $75,062 at Neiman Marcus in Minneapolis, $49,425 at Saks Fifth Avenue, $4,902 at the men's clothier, Atelier, and $92 for a romper and matching hat with ears for baby Trig at Pacifier, a Minneapolis baby store.

Clothing costs skyrocket for 'hockey mom'

She was dismayed to hear yesterday that the Republican Party had spent $150,000 in two months on clothes, hair styling, and accessories for Sarah Palin and her family from such upscale stores as Saks Fifth Avenue and Nieman Marcus.

Republican style spree clashes with Palin's visit

They included approximate payments to such high-end retailers as Neiman Marcus ($75,000); Saks Fifth Avenue ($50,000); Barney's New York ($800); Bloomingdale's ($5,100); Atelier (a tony menswear shop) $4,900, and even the comparatively humble Macy's ($9,500).
